Output 43043fae610ebb9b7fdd07b90d5990ccac1fc7074a2f58a0cbaf987640c8ba44:1

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 121f4927f2491574ab67e51109c07a9bb80132e4 OP_EQUALVERIFY OP_CHECKSIG
address
12epeE7UcSrxzDRfYrb2WwwA4jVjXwoiaK
transaction
43043fae610ebb9b7fdd07b90d5990ccac1fc7074a2f58a0cbaf987640c8ba44
spent
true